Indirect object in the Smith family prepared us a delicious meal
pochemuha

The indirect object in the sentence indicated above is "us"

<h3>What is an indirect object?</h3>

An indirect object is one that is used with a transitive verb to express who benefits from or receives something as a result of an activity.

For example, 'him' is the indirect object in 'He handed him his contact number.'
